2. Regulatory Conformity & Risk Management
There are numerous regulations that will impact almost any engineering project. A attorney can help with making certain a project is compliance with appropriate planning and zoning laws and this any necessary permits or approvals are obtained. A attorney can also help a client navigate and adhere to regulations regarding workplace safety, and also other risk management issues.
